agent-building
Intermediate
Always open

Build a Customer Support Agent

Build a sophisticated AI agent that customer support agent. This challenge focuses on creating intelligent systems that can understand context, maintain conversation state, and provide valuable automated assistance.

Challenge brief

What you are building

The core problem, expected build, and operating context for this challenge.

Build a sophisticated AI agent that customer support agent. This challenge focuses on creating intelligent systems that can understand context, maintain conversation state, and provide valuable automated assistance.

Datasets

Shared data for this challenge

Review public datasets and any private uploads tied to your build.

Loading datasets...
Learning goals

What you should walk away with

Build a conversational AI agent using a rule-based system.

Implement natural language understanding (NLU) components.

Design a dialogue management system for context maintenance.

Develop an agent capable of handling multiple conversation turns.

Integrate a knowledge base for improved response accuracy.

Start from your terminal
$npx -y @versalist/cli start build-a-customer-support-agent

[ok] Wrote CHALLENGE.md

[ok] Wrote .versalist.json

[ok] Wrote eval/examples.json

Requires VERSALIST_API_KEY. Works with any MCP-aware editor.

Docs
Manage API keys
Challenge at a glance
Host and timing
Vera

AI Research & Mentorship

Starts Available now
Evergreen challenge
Your progress

Participation status

You haven't started this challenge yet

Timeline and host

Operating window

Key dates and the organization behind this challenge.

Start date
Available now
Run mode
Evergreen challenge
Explore

Find another challenge

Jump to a random challenge when you want a fresh benchmark or a different problem space.

Useful when you want to pressure-test your workflow on a new dataset, new constraints, or a new evaluation rubric.

Tool Space Recipe

Draft
Evaluation

Frequently Asked Questions about Build a Customer Support Agent